Archaeology Notes
NO53NE 110 c.590 360
NO 590 360 Annular brooch of brown metal found by metal detecting. Brooch is complete; ring and pin are bent and brooch is cracked in two places but is in fair condition. Diam. 30mm; pin 33mm. Declared Treasure Trove (TT42/98) and purchased for the collections. Acc. no. C2001.97.
NO 590 360 Twelve medieval objects, eleven of metal and one pottery sherd, found while metal detecting. Metal objects include: two dagger chapes; book clasp; three buttons; three buckles. Declared Treasure Trove (TT 67/98) and purchased for the collections. Acc. nos C2001.99 a to l.
Sponsors: Angus Council, National Funds for Acquisitions.
R Benvie 2003
